To make a long story short, my husband had disabled our security on our wireless router so that he could sync his Iphone. He then switched it back and since then we can't connect to our wireless network. It either says there's an error connecting to it, or that the password we entered is wrong. My internet provider said we should contact Linksys bcus it's likely a problem with the wireless security settings and our Macs(we have 2 identical laptops) not seeing "eye to eye."

To make a long story short - the quickest way is to start from scratch, really.

Press and hold down the reset button on the router for 30 seconds while it is plugged in to the outlet.

This will clear everything, but will be in a default state. Change the SSID and password to what you want then connect each device to the new SSID with the new password.

If that doesn't work - buy a new router.
